WebNov 10, 2014 · Malignant proliferating trichilemmal tumor (MPTT) is a dermal or subcutaneous neoplasm with squamoid cytologic features and trichilemmal-type keratinization. The term MPTT was entered in the literature in 1983 because of a proliferating trichilemmal tumor that showed infiltrative growth pattern, marked cytologic …

WebInverted follicular keratoses are predominantly endophytic tumors with large lobules or finger-like projections of tumor cells extending into the dermis. An exophytic growth pattern is present in some lesions, and it is occasionally the dominant feature.
